- 博客(13)
- 收藏
- 关注
原创 汽车报文中:数据存储的大端序
其实大小端序一直很容易搞混的,上周项目的配置字分析也是因为地址高低和数据高低一直区别不开。这样是为自己做一个总结数据的低序字节保存在内存的低地址,数据的高序字节保存在内存的高地址。数据的高序字节保存在内存的低地址,数据的低序字节保存在内存的高地址。汽车行业使用的大多是大端。
2024-07-19 16:47:38
347
原创 数据结构内存分配
内存也是我们使用过程中容易忽略的一个细节,特别是通过指针地址的方式访问结构体里面的成员时,会遇到获取的值和自己需要的值不一致的原因。这个问题也是我的同事遇到的。规则2:每个成员的起始地址为:该成员类型所占内存的整数倍(第一个成员起始位地址为0),如果不足部分用数据填充到所占内存的整数倍。一般情况下,枚举是使用多少数据,就是占多少内存。在32位时,只有数据不超过32位,大小都是32位,如果超过就按照使用的倍数计算。规则2.大小能够被它所包含的所有的基本数据类型的大小整除。规则1.大小必须足够容纳最宽的成员。
2024-07-17 18:38:05
397
原创 关于CAN网络个人总结----23年总结(新手)
在我一年的工作生涯(23年1月到-24年1月)中,我学会了很多,无论是做人还是做事。我现在很是感叹,师傅的逻辑能力真强,居然能听懂我前言不搭后语的问题。嘿嘿,此时的我想高歌一曲(羡慕)。后面一问,z同事喜欢往教室后排做,怪说不得,认不到。他也很好,我对单片机内存那一块不太懂,我就天天问,晚上也逮着他问(主要我问师傅好几遍了,不太好意思继续问,师傅业务繁忙)。总结下来,我的新手职业生涯很愉快,简直太顺利了(比起我男朋友,他领导据说是华为几级,老喜欢骂人了,都骂走了两位同事了。
2024-04-09 16:29:11
238
原创 【毕业设计】基于zigbee的智能鱼缸(鱼塘)养殖系统
给大家介绍一下这个单片机项目基于zigbee的智能鱼缸(鱼塘)养殖本系统主要用到的ZigBee协议栈基础代码分享该项目是物联网三层架构,感知层、网络层、应用层。1.1 感知层。
2024-04-09 16:20:29
2018
原创 MC9S12G128 系统总线时钟配置(选择外部晶振为时钟源8MHZ)
MC9S12G128 系统总线时钟配置(选择外部晶振为时钟源8MHZ)外加原理讲解
2023-02-11 08:00:00
1046
原创 MC9S12G128 led点亮 key按键
MC9S12G128 led点亮 key按键寄存器解析 主要是通用IO口的寄存器配置方向寄存器 DDRP 0 为输入 1为输出数据寄存器 PTP 0为置低 1为置高
2023-02-06 14:19:25
233
智慧鱼塘(鱼缸)养殖系统的底层部分(ZigBee)
2023-08-25
MC9S128 CAN发送接收完整源代码 飞思卡尔CAN发送接收
2023-02-15
基于STM32的智能仓储系统
2023-02-15
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人